Sunday, Aug. 22, The Stand Newspaper held its 2021 Photo Bash announcing the winners of its annual photo contest. The evening started at Wildflowers Armory, where the winners were announced. Next, the UNiTY Street Band led a parade to the Everson Museum of Art where, in partnership with the Urban Video Project, photos from the entrants were projected on to the side of the museum. The screening continues from dusk to 11 p.m. each evening through Aug. 25.
